Warning Signs You Need Slab Leak Water Removal
Early detection is key with slab leaks. Here are some war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ors in your home can be a sign of a slab leak. If you notice persistent musty smells, it’s time to call us.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ls
Water stains on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of a slab leak. If you notice any discoloration or water spots, don’t delay, call us today.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of a slab leak. If you notice any uneven or damaged flooring, it’s time to call us.
Increased Water Bills
Unexpected increases in your water bills can be a sign of a slab leak. If you notice any unusual spikes in your water usage, it’s time to investigate.
Water Sounds Under Your Floor
Strange sounds under your floor, such as gurgling or running water, can be a sign of a slab leak. If you notice any unusual noises, don’t hesitate to call us.
Foundation Cracks or Shifts
Cracks or shifts in your foundation can be a sign of a slab leak. If you notice any unusual movement or damage to your foundation, it’s time to call us.

Slab Leak Water Removal Cost in Agoura Hills, CA
The cost of slab leak water removal can vary widely depending on the severity of the leak,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Agoura Hills, CA.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of leak, and equipment needed |
| Dehumidification and s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used, and level of sanitizing required |
| Repair and reconstruction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ials needed, and level of labor required |
| Insurance claims and documentation | $0 – $500 | Severity of damage, type of insurance coverage, and level of documentation required |
| Emergency services (after-hours or weekend calls) | $200 – $500 | Time of day, level of urgency, and equipment needed |
| More services (mold remediation, structural repair) |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of services needed, and level of labor required |

Common Questions About Slab Leak Water Removal
Q: How long does slab leak water removal take?
A: The length of time it takes to complete slab leak water removal depends on the severity of the leak, the size of the affected area, and the level of equipment needed. Typically, it can take anywhere from a few hours to several days to complete.

Q: How do I prevent slab leaks in the future?
A: To prevent slab leaks, it’s essential to regularly inspect your pipes and plumbing system for signs of damage or wear. Also, consider having your slab inspected every 5-10 years to identify any potential issues before they become major problems.
